Overview
A financial technology organization is seeking a Senior Credit Risk Analyst to join their Enterprise Risk Management team. This role combines credit risk analytics, data science, and strategic risk management to support credit risk strategy at a fast-growing fintech bank.
Responsibilities
- Monitor credit performance across consumer and commercial portfolios
- Build and maintain credit risk dashboards providing real-time portfolio health visibility for senior management and the Board
- Analyze early warning signals such as 7-day delinquency, payment behavior changes, and credit utilization patterns to predict portfolio stress
- Track key credit risk indicators (KRIs) including delinquency rates, charge-off metrics, risk grade distributions, and concentration limits as defined in the Bank's Risk Appetite Statement
- Prepare monthly and quarterly credit risk reports for management and board committees
- Lead or challenge credit risk assessments for new products, partnerships, underwriting policy changes, and portfolio expansion initiatives
- Collaborate with Credit, Underwriting, and Product teams to implement corrective actions and prevent recurrence
- Support regulatory examinations by preparing credit risk documentation, responding to examiner requests, and presenting portfolio performance

Compensation & Benefits
Compensation is market-based and varies by location within the United States, categorized into four zones based on cost of labor indices:
- Zone A: $148,700–$223,100 USD
- Zone B: $138,300–$207,500 USD
- Zone C: $130,900–$196,300 USD
- Zone D: $123,400–$185,200 USD
Starting pay is determined by job-related skills, experience, qualifications, work location, and market conditions. Benefits include remote work options, medical insurance, flexible time off, retirement savings plans, and family planning support.
